Woman Assaulted, Carjacked In Groveton: Police
Over the weekend, a woman was assaulted and carjacked, while a 7-Eleven was robbed in Groveton.

GROVETON, VA—The suspects in carjacking and a 7-Eleven robbery were arrested in Groveton over the weekend.
The carjacking happened in the 3000 block of Furman Lane Saturday. Around 12:15 a.m., the victim was walking to her car when approached by two men. The men pushed her down and demanded money. The suspects took her wallet and car keys, fleeing in her car.
Not long afterward, Fairfax County Police arrested John Williams, 19, and a 17-year-old, both of District Heights, Md.

The 7-Eleven robbery occurred at 6946 South Kings Highway Sunday. Around 2:30 a.m., the suspect appeared to go to the counter to check out. When the cashier was ringing up the item, the suspect jumped over the counter and began stealing money. He left in a getaway car outside.
Police soon arrested the robber Arvel Caldwell, 39, and the driver, Ronald Carter, 56, both of Washington, DC.
